Playing and editing clips
The information in this chapter describes how to play and edit clips recorded on the
K2 Media Client. You can play clips in a variety of ways including off-speed play and
triggered by GPI. In addition to editing existing clips, you can create new clips using
the subclip feature and add cue points to clips.
